CALIFORNIA PUBLIC EMPLOYEES ' <br /> DEFERRED COMPENSATION PLAN <br /> The purpose of this Plan is to provide deferred <br /> compensation for California public employees that elect to <br /> participate in the Plan. This Plan is established pursuant to <br /> sections 21670 through 21678 of the Government Code of the State <br /> of California and is intended to constitute an "eligible deferred <br /> compensation plan" within the meaning of section 457 of the <br /> Federal Internal Revenue Code . <br /> ARTICLE 1 DEFINITIONS <br /> The following terms when used herein shall have the <br /> following meaning: <br /> 1 . 1 Account : The bookkeeping account maintained with <br /> respect to each Participant which reflects the value of the <br /> deferred compensation credited to the Participant, including the <br /> Participant ' s Deferrals, the earnings or loss of the Fund (net of <br /> Fund expenses) allocable to the Participant, any Transfers for <br /> the Participant ' s benefit, and any distributions made to the <br /> Participant or the Participant ' s Beneficiary. <br /> 1 . 2 Adoption Agreement : The agreement under which an <br /> Employer becomes a participating Employer under this Plan. <br /> 1 . 3 Beneficiary: The person or persons designated by <br /> the Participant to receive distributions from the Participant's <br /> Account after the Participant ' s death. <br /> 1 .4 Board: The Board of Administration of PERS . <br /> 1 , 5 Code : The Federal Internal Revenue Code of 1986, <br /> as amended from time to time . <br />
